Medical Minute: How Does Laser Hair Removal Work?
In the summertime in northern climates and all year round in southern climates, people look forward to laying by the pool and soaking in some sun. But this also involves waxing and shaving often sensitive areas of our bodies every few weeks and dealing with pain and razor bumps to look good in our swimsuits. Thankfully there are options for permanently reducing body hair through laser hair treatments. How does this work? Our hair has color because of melanin. There are two types of Pheomelanin which is in red or blond hair and Eumelanin which is in brown or black hair. Medical Minute: Can Lasers Help Facial Rosacea?
Rosacea is a very common skin condition. It starts with a tendency to flush more easily than other individuals, and can evolve into redness on the nose, cheeks, chin and forehead. Some patients get bumps on their face associated with rosacea and it can also affect the eyelids, resulting in dry eye. The cause of rosacea is not known, but it does tend to run in families with fair skin. It often flares up when triggers such as exercise, sun exposure, hot weather, stress, spicy food, alcohol and hot baths are present.
